#1ebc90 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ebc90 is composed of 11.8% red, 73.7%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.4%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 163.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 42.7%. #1ebc90 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cffff with #007921.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#1ebc90 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ebc90 has RGB values of R:30, G:188,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 2014352.

Shades and Tints of #1ebc90
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f9 is the lightest one.
